You can sustain various types of injuries and get back on your feet after treatment. However, some injuries can be catastrophic, resulting in lifelong or long-term damages. Various aspects of your everyday life change when you sustain catastrophic injuries. This means you may never be able to work again or do what you used to do with ease. Some of the catastrophic injuries you can sustain are severe disfigurement, severe burns, amputations, spinal cord injuries, serious internal injuries, severe scarring, traumatic brain injuries, compound bone fractures, and paralysis. 

You can sustain these injuries due to medical malpractice, defective products, car crashes, sports accidents, or truck accidents, among other causes. As a catastrophic injury victim, you should hire a catastrophic injury attorney to help you file a claim, and here's why it's a smart idea.

The Lawyer Knows the Kind of Settlement You Deserve

It's one thing to file a claim after sustaining catastrophic injuries, and it's another thing to know the amount you should receive or expect. Unfortunately, knowing the amount of financial settlement you should receive is never easy without the help of a catastrophic injury attorney. The lawyer considers things like mental injuries, physical therapy, travel expenses to and from the medical facility, pain endured, household services, nursing care, and lost wages when estimating the amount of financial compensation you should expect. So hiring a lawyer is a plus because you won't lose your settlement or be under-compensated.
